Thea Render features and specs

  • Versatile Rendering
    Thea Render offers both biased and unbiased rendering options, providing flexibility for different types of rendering projects, from photorealistic images to faster, approximate results.
  • Integration with Popular Software
    It integrates seamlessly with popular 3D modeling software such as SketchUp, Rhino, and Cinema4D, making it easier to include in existing workflows.
  • Advanced Material Editor
    Thea Render features an advanced material editor that allows detailed customization of textures and materials, enabling more realistic and complex surface representations.
  • High-Quality Output
    The engine produces high-quality rendering with detailed lighting and textures, suitable for professional-grade visualization and presentation.
  • Interactive Render
    It provides interactive rendering capabilities, allowing for real-time adjustments and immediate feedback on changes made to the scene.

Possible disadvantages of Thea Render

  • Learning Curve
    Due to its advanced features and capabilities, Thea Render can have a steep learning curve, especially for users who are new to rendering software.
  • Resource Intensive
    Rendering in high quality can be resource-intensive, requiring powerful hardware to maintain efficiency and performance.
  • Price
    Thea Render is a commercial product, and its cost may be a consideration for freelancers or small studios with limited budgets.
  • Occasional Compatibility Issues
    While it integrates well with many modeling tools, some users have reported occasional compatibility issues or bugs that need to be resolved.
  • Limited Animation Features
    Compared to some specialized renderers, Thea Render may have limited features for complex animation projects, making it less suitable for certain types of work.

CodeLighthouse features and specs

  • Real-time error monitoring
    CodeLighthouse provides real-time error tracking and monitoring for applications, allowing developers to quickly identify and respond to issues as they occur in production environments.
  • Easy integration
    The platform offers straightforward integration with popular programming languages and frameworks, making it relatively simple for development teams to get started with minimal setup effort.
  • Actionable error insights
    CodeLighthouse provides detailed error reports with contextual information, stack traces, and relevant metadata that help developers quickly diagnose and fix issues rather than just alerting them to problems.
  • Developer-friendly design
    The platform is built with developers in mind, offering a clean interface and developer-centric workflows that reduce the friction typically associated with error monitoring and debugging tools.
  • Affordable for small teams
    CodeLighthouse positions itself as a cost-effective solution for smaller development teams and startups that need error monitoring without the premium price tag of larger enterprise-focused competitors.

Possible disadvantages of CodeLighthouse

  • Limited market presence
    CodeLighthouse is a relatively small and lesser-known player in the error monitoring space, which means fewer community resources, third-party integrations, and peer support compared to established tools like Sentry or Datadog.
  • Smaller ecosystem of integrations
    Compared to more established competitors, CodeLighthouse may offer fewer out-of-the-box integrations with third-party tools, CI/CD pipelines, and communication platforms, potentially requiring additional custom work.
  • Limited language and framework support
    As a smaller platform, CodeLighthouse may not support as wide a range of programming languages and frameworks as larger, more mature error monitoring solutions.
  • Uncertain long-term viability
    Being a smaller company, there may be concerns about long-term sustainability and continued development, which could be a risk factor for teams making a long-term tooling commitment.
  • Fewer advanced features
    CodeLighthouse may lack some of the more advanced features offered by larger competitors, such as sophisticated performance monitoring, AI-powered error grouping, or extensive analytics and reporting capabilities.
